Head to the Twilight Dunes or Sakurajima

There's an easy spot to farm Nightstar Sand in the Dessicated Dunes at night. Just take the fast travel point to the Searing Dunes Watchtower, look north, and glide off of the cliff ledge to the glowing sand nodes below.

Nightstar Sand nodes are only visible when it's dark out, but their faint glow begins just as the sun sets in the evening. You can even get lucky and stumble upon it during daylight hours, but that relies on luck and paying close attention to the action prompt. You likely won't need very much, and I had plenty to make the items I wanted after a few nightly trips.

  • Feybreak Island beaches have way more Nightstar Sand than the dunes, but it's a tough area to navigate at lower levels. Visiting the Searing Dunes location was an easier trip when I was alone or under-levelled.
  • The Dessicated Dunes have more Nightstar Sand around the Tower of the PIDF, but deposits there seem pretty sparse. I wouldn't spend a lot of time hunting for more sand further away from the fast travel point recommended.

Feybreak Island deposits often extend further inland, so follow trails of Nightstar Sand from the light-colored beaches into the grassy areas. I've gotten around 100 just from one night.

The Dessicated Dunes Nightstar Sand deposits are sparse, so don't pull your hair out scavenging for more. The dunes don't have much foliage either, so you'll see the glow from a mile away.

The glowing sand is mostly used to make weapons, tools, and accessories, so you won't need a hefty supply for things like ammo or potions. Here are a few crafting recipes for reference:

  • Advanced Bow: (20) Nightstar Sand, (25) Carbon Fiber, (40) Plasteel
  • Beam Sword: (20) Nightstar Sand, (30) Plasteel, (100) Palladium, (1) Computer
  • Metal Detector: (20) Nightstar Sand, (30) Plasteel, (100) Palladium, (15) Computer
  • Double Air Dash Boots: (30) Nightstar Sand, (30) Plasteel, (100) Palladium, (30) Dark Fragments

Moss Developer Polyarc Is Shutting Down🎮 Multi-platform

Moss Developer Polyarc Is Shutting Down

!Game Informer News(https://gameinformer.com/sites/default/files/styles/bodydefault/public/2026/09/11/050f61cd/moss-screenshot.jpg.webp) Polyarc, the developer best known for the acclaimed Moss series of VR and console games, has announced its closing its doors. This marks the end of the studio’s almost 12-year run. On LinkedIn(https://www.linkedin.com/posts/today-is-the-end-of-an-era-for-polyarc-share-7504247060351758337-zaR2/), Polyarc’s official profile posted this message: “After nearly 12 years riding the joyous rollercoaster of emotions that is making video games, our time together has come to an end. As we wind down active development, we are saying our farewells to each other. Working together over all of these years has been an honor. Bringing surprise and delight to those who played our games has been a privilege. Thank you to everyone at Polyarc, our work is now finished.” The message concludes with a reverse recruiting spreadsheet with contact information for the studio's employees. Polyarc burst onto the scene with 2018’s Moss(https://gameinformer.com/games/moss/b/playstationvr/archive/2018/02/27/game-informer-moss-psvr-review.aspx), an action-adventure puzzle game that shone as one of the more well-received VR titles of the time. It followed up with Moss: Book II in 2022. This July, Polyarc released Moss: The Forgotten Relic, a non-VR adventure combining both Moss games into a single title. Sadly, Polyarc isn’t the only studio to meet its end this year.
